IP查询
查询
你查询的IP:[119.141.71.62] 地理位置:中国–广东–东莞
最新查询
60.40.162.176
124.172.24.28
124.172.233.89
59.32.161.198
120.149.5.110
118.224.191.142
60.31.147.255
218.60.146.240
119.172.158.148
119.141.71.62
222.248.70.118
123.184.223.1
202.131.208.129
116.58.208.136
123.128.240.158
210.76.85.98
202.38.158.1
58.68.128.114
203.148.33.8
202.120.111.182
202.43.144.19
116.192.102.210
203.99.80.93
202.38.128.129
124.29.19.175
203.222.192.213
203.118.192.210
202.95.252.56
121.224.5.0
218.56.139.57
202.148.96.217